NEPLP repeatedly loses “Prohibited Method” for Covid-19 Vaccine Efficacy Program / Article

The court decided to annul the decision of NEPLP of June 17 last year and close the administrative violation case.

The judgment may be appealed to the Riga Regional Court within ten working days of its notification.

CONTEXT:

Last year, the NEPLP decided to impose a fine of 4,000 euros on the LTV program “Prohibited Method” for the information released on March 29 regarding the effectiveness of the vaccine against Covid-19.

LTV appealed the penalty. The Court of First Instance decided to dismiss the action, while the Court of Appeal decided to remit the case to the Court of First Instance.

The main reason was that the judgment of the judge of the court of first instance was not sufficiently motivated, it was established that it was not formed in accordance with the requirements of the law and should therefore be annulled. The grounds of the voluminous judgment consist essentially of quotations from the case-law, but lack an assessment of the facts of the case. This was also stated in the appeal.

“Prohibited Technique” in the experiment tested antibodies to Pfizer ‘s second vaccine and AstraZeneca’ s first vaccine. The Swan Laboratory test found that AstraZeneca had fewer antibodies after the vaccine.

Dace Zavadska, Chair of the National Council for Immunization pointed outthat the measurement of the development of antibodies after vaccination against Covid-19 does not provide sufficient conclusions as to whether the amount of antibody is sufficient or not. Thus, the “Prohibited Method” experiment just confused people’s minds. At the same time, Zavadska does not plan to take any action against journalists.

LTV does not consider that the information on the effectiveness of the AstraZeneca vaccine in the Prohibited Method program would be withdrawn and that the media team would not be penalized in any way by the media. Accordingly media watchdogs fined LTVwho appealed against that decision to the Court, and the court overturned the sentence.
